Arsenal gunning for Costa Rica striker Campbell

Costa Rican forward Joel Campbell (left) vies for the ball with Argentine midfielder Fernando Gago during a Copa America match. (AFP)

Arsenal are edging toward a deal for Saprissa striker Joel Campbell, it has been reported.

The Costa Rica international has caught the eye of several clubs across Europe after impressing for his country at Copa America, having scored a goal in the 2-0 victory against Bolivia.

Saprissa have approved the sale of the 19-year-old, coming to a $2 million (€1.3 million) agreement with Arsenal in principle and a deal could be announced on Tuesday.

Despite Campbell's father claiming earlier this month that a transfer to Arsenal had been put on hold after other clubs had expressed interest in the player, it is believed that an improved bid from the Premier League side was enough to convince all parties.

Campbell, who spent the last season on loan at Puntarenas, will only join Arsenal after the Under-20 World Cup in Colombia, where Costa Rica will take on Australia, Ecuador and Spain.
